![]() With lithium ion battery installations running around $405 per kilowatt-hour, Ambri’s battery technology is already poised to be somewhat disruptive at a cost of about half that. One that seems to be bucking this trend is the liquid metal battery, which startup Ambri is putting into service on the electrical grid next year. Multi-layered solar panels, wave and tidal energy, and hydrogen fuel cells are all things that are real but can’t seem to break through and overtake other lower cost, simpler, and proven technologies. Whether that’s due to cost issues, production, or scalability, we’re often teased with industry breakthroughs that never come to fruition. The news is rife with claims of the next great thing in clean energy generation, but most of these technologies never make it to production.
